"Window treatment store"
All cities
Сhoice insight
Home
Cities
Glendale
Window treatment store
Screenmobile
Sc
Screenmobile
21650 N 58th Ave, Glendale, AZ 85308, United States
Appearance
Information
Working hours
Services
Similar organizations
Information
Address:
21650 N 58th Ave, Glendale, AZ 85308, United States
Top stores in CA:
Site One El Cajon
Gorman Industries Albuquerque
Fastener Express
Edit info
Last News:
goodwill-powell photos
ryerson richmond va
eg industries rochester
nate packaging
hot topic great falls mt
old master products santa ana
Categories
Window treatment store
Similar organizations
Western Window Coverings
4350 W Corrine Dr, Glendale, AZ 85304, United States
SWK Home Innovations
6635 W Happy Valley Rd, Glendale, AZ 85310, United States
Blind Ideas
5449 N 51st Ave #101, Glendale, AZ 85301, United States
Arizona Shutters and Cabinets
5775 N 51st Ave, Glendale, AZ 85301, United States
Screen Specialists
6016 N 57th Ave, Glendale, AZ 85301, United States
The Home Depot
6160 W Behrend Dr, Glendale, AZ 85308, United States
NuVision Window Films
5623 N Green Bay Ave, Glendale, WI 53209, United States
Arrowhead Carpet Tile & Interiors
6232 W Bell Rd #103, Glendale, AZ 85308, United States
CC Sunscreens
5237 W Montebello Ave suite c8, Glendale, AZ 85301, United States
Vi
Viewpoint Shutter & Shade
7939 W Colter St, Glendale, AZ 85303, United States